Output 863899526d6995cef54f02a96948c0121a744c2eee57761e01cc9847cc892535:0

value
17353324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e62ae4d763774add9032a81b45564ccea414fb2 OP_EQUALVERIFY OP_CHECKSIG
address
13mfVDsZLD6R8QbFEJu61d89nkSvNWNXtY
transaction
863899526d6995cef54f02a96948c0121a744c2eee57761e01cc9847cc892535
spent
true